Poodle Price Overview

As of 2026, a Poodle puppy from a reputable breeder typically costs between $1000 and $2500. Standard Poodles from reputable breeders cost $2,000 to $3,500. Show-quality and health-tested dogs can exceed $5,000. Adopt-a-Poodle rescues are also available..

The initial purchase price is just the beginning. First-year costs including supplies, veterinary care, and food typically total around $4,588. Ongoing monthly expenses average about $169 per month.

Where to Buy a Poodle

The best sources for a Poodle ($1000–$2500 from breeders) include:

  • Reputable breeders: Look for breeders who health-test for Hip Dysplasia and other breed-specific conditions
  • Breed-specific rescue: As the #5 most popular AKC breed, Poodles appear in rescue regularly ($150–$500)
  • AKC Marketplace: A directory of AKC-registered breeders with verified listings

Avoid pet stores, puppy mills, and online sellers who cannot provide health testing documentation. A responsible Poodle breeder will welcome your questions and want to ensure their puppies go to suitable homes.

Scam Warning

A Poodle priced far below $1000 should raise immediate red flags. Reputable breeders invest $500+ per parent in health testing (including Hip Dysplasia screening), quality nutrition, and proper socialization—costs reflected in the $1000–$2500 price range. Adoption is a wonderful option for finding a Poodle. Rescue fees of $150–$500 typically include spay/neuter, vaccinations, and microchipping–a significant saving versus the $1000–$2500 breeder price. Many rescued Poodles are adults with established temperaments, which removes puppy-phase uncertainty. Their curly and dense coat and medium size should factor into your readiness assessment.
Monthly expenses for a Poodle average $169. Food costs are moderate at $65–99/month for this medium-sized breed. Grooming their curly and dense coat adds $36–85/month. Insurance runs $32–62/month, and annual vet costs add $422–679.
